The development of both myeloid cells and immunocytes from a common stem cell precursor, their differentiated pathways, functions and the factors which modulate them are briefly reviewed here. The age‐related decline (or lack of it) for the several cell lines is outlined, as well as the effect of this upon life processes and homeostasis. The results from two approaches to extending high levels of immune responses in aged mice are reviewed.
